如何确定服务器上可运行的最大虚拟机数量?

小贝
预计阅读时长 6 分钟
位置: 首页 自媒体运营 正文

服务器虚拟机最大数量

在现代IT环境中,虚拟化技术已成为提高资源利用率和灵活性的重要手段,通过将多个虚拟机(VM)部署在同一台物理服务器上,企业可以更高效地利用硬件资源,降低运营成本,并简化管理流程,确定一台物理服务器能运行多少个虚拟机并没有一个固定的答案,它取决于多种因素,包括硬件配置、虚拟机的资源需求以及具体的应用场景等,本文将探讨影响服务器上虚拟机数量的主要因素,并提供一些实用的建议来帮助您规划和优化您的虚拟化环境。

服务器虚拟机最大数量

一、硬件配置的影响

1、CPU资源:CPU是决定虚拟机数量的关键因素之一,现代多核处理器能够支持大量并发线程,但每个核心的实际负载能力有限,一个具有12个逻辑处理器的Intel Xeon E5-2699 V3处理器可以提供强大的计算能力,但具体能支撑多少个虚拟机还需考虑其他因素。

2、内存容量:内存同样是限制虚拟机数量的重要因素,每台虚拟机都需要分配一定量的内存来保证其正常运行,因此物理服务器的总内存大小直接影响到可以运行的虚拟机数量,如果每个虚拟机配置了4GB内存,那么一台拥有32GB内存的服务器理论上可以支持8个这样的虚拟机。

3、存储空间:虽然存储设备通常不是最直接的瓶颈,但在高IOPS(输入/输出操作每秒)场景下,磁盘性能也可能成为限制因素,使用SSD而非传统HDD可以提高存储性能,从而支持更多的虚拟机。

4、网络带宽:如果所有虚拟机共享同一网络接口卡(NIC),则网络流量可能会成为瓶颈,通过增加额外的NIC或使用更高吞吐量的网络适配器可以帮助缓解这一问题。

二、虚拟机资源消耗情况

不同类型的应用程序对资源的消耗差异很大,Web服务器可能只需要较少的CPU和内存资源,而数据库服务器则需要更多的计算能力和内存,在规划虚拟机数量时,需要根据实际的应用需求来进行评估。

应用类型 平均每虚拟机所需CPU核心数 平均每虚拟机所需内存(GB)
Web服务器 0.5 2
数据库服务器 2 8
开发环境 1 4
服务器虚拟机最大数量

三、最佳实践与建议

1、性能测试:在实际部署前进行性能测试是非常重要的步骤,这可以帮助您了解特定硬件配置下能够支持的最大虚拟机数量,并确保系统稳定运行。

2、资源预留:为了避免过度分配导致性能下降,建议为关键任务预留一部分资源,可以为重要的数据库服务保留至少20%的CPU和内存资源。

3、动态调整:利用虚拟化平台的自动扩展功能,可以根据实时需求动态调整虚拟机的资源分配,这样既保证了服务质量,又提高了资源利用率。

4、监控与管理:定期检查虚拟机的性能指标,及时发现并解决潜在问题,使用专业的监控工具可以帮助管理员更好地掌握整个虚拟化环境的状态。

四、常见问题解答

Q1: 一台物理服务器最多可以运行多少个虚拟机?

服务器虚拟机最大数量

A1: 没有固定答案,取决于服务器的具体硬件配置、虚拟机的资源需求以及工作负载类型等因素,一般情况下,现代高端服务器在理想条件下可以支持数十甚至上百个轻量级虚拟机。

Q2: 如果我想在我的办公室PC上安装几个虚拟机用于学习目的,应该选择什么样的配置?

A2: 对于个人学习用途,推荐至少配备8GB RAM(最好是16GB)、四核处理器以及足够的硬盘空间(建议SSD),这样的配置应该能够满足大多数情况下同时运行两到三个虚拟机的需求。

确定一台物理服务器能运行多少个虚拟机是一个复杂的过程,需要考虑多种技术和业务因素,通过合理的规划和管理,您可以充分利用现有的硬件资源,实现高效的虚拟化部署,希望本文提供的信息能够帮助您更好地理解这一主题,并为您的虚拟化项目提供有价值的参考。

以上就是关于“服务器虚拟机最大数量”的问题,朋友们可以点击主页了解更多内容,希望可以够帮助大家!

-- 展开阅读全文 --
头像
服务器能否绑定两个域名?
« 上一篇 2024-12-02
如何制定有效的服务器维保安全管理制度?
下一篇 » 2024-12-02
取消
微信二维码
支付宝二维码

发表评论

暂无评论,2人围观

目录[+]